Meaning: Princess Diana, also known as the People's Princess, was a beloved and influential figure known for her charitable work and advocacy for various humanitarian causes. The quote "Everyone of us needs to show how much we care for each other and, in the process, care for ourselves" encapsulates her philosophy of compassion, empathy, and the interconnectedness of individuals within a community.

Princess Diana's words reflect the importance of fostering a culture of care and support among people. By emphasizing the need to show care for each other, she highlights the significance of empathy and understanding in building strong, cohesive communities. The idea that caring for others is a way of caring for oneself underscores the reciprocal nature of compassion – when individuals extend kindness and support to others, they also benefit personally by fostering a sense of fulfillment, connection, and purpose.

In the context of Princess Diana's life and work, this quote aligns with her commitment to philanthropy and her efforts to bring attention to marginalized and vulnerable communities. Throughout her public life, she championed causes such as the eradication of landmines, the destigmatization of HIV/AIDS, and support for individuals facing homelessness and poverty. Her advocacy and hands-on approach to humanitarian work demonstrated her belief in the transformative power of caring for others and the positive impact it can have on both individuals and society as a whole.
